**2,4-Diamino–5–phenyl–6–ethylpyrimidine** is a synthetic small molecule belonging to the aminopyrimidine class of heterocyclic aromatic organic compounds. It has the molecular formula C12H14N4 and a molecular weight of approximately 214.27 g/mol[1][2][9]. The compound is structurally related to pyrimethamine but lacks the para-chloro substituent on the phenyl ring[5]. It has been studied as an experimental agent and is not approved for clinical use in any country[1][7]. Its mechanism of action includes inhibition of thymidylate synthase based on biochemical studies and structural data from ligand-protein complexes[7]. No approved indications or marketed formulations are known.
